The U.S. is moving air and ballistic missile defense systems into Iraq to protect against a potential Iranian attack following the escalation in January

The rocket attack that killed two American service members in northern Iraq late Wednesday was “most likely” carried out by an Iran-backed Shia militia group, the general in charge of U.S. forces in the Middle East told senators on Thursday.

Following the attack, reports emerged of airstrikes on Iran’s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ps positions on Abu Kamal near the border between Iraq and Syria. However, the U.S. official said those strikes were not conducted by the United States. It is possible the Israeli military carried out the strikes.
